New York City to Become First City to Directly Fund Abortions

Share:

New York City could become the first city to directly fund abortions if the city council votes to approve $250,000 to be allocated to the New York Abortion Access Fund.

On Friday, Mayor Bill de Blasio and City Council Speaker Corey Johnson revealed a new budget agreement, which would allocate $250,000 to the New York Abortion Access Fund for women who cannot afford an abortion.

De Blasio called the abortion funding a “step up” for the city, as the funding would make New York City the first city in America to fund abortion services.
